Output 616934f139b7156672ca9ab1d1090ec758dab810a60eb68d64343f8c5d7daeb3:1

value
7530858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ba4da54e5b5be048051a7f44c0deebf6cd02630 OP_EQUAL
address
378PH3Dryj73R3e6PdAga5jyRa2rgKj8E2
transaction
616934f139b7156672ca9ab1d1090ec758dab810a60eb68d64343f8c5d7daeb3
confirmations
267214
spent
true